The convergence of semiconductor efficiency, multispectral emission, and intelligent cooling.
Modern clinics demand multi-wavelength solutions. Simultaneously emitting 755nm (melanin absorption), 808nm (standard hair removal), and 1064nm (deep follicular penetration) allows providers to safely treat all Fitzpatrick skin types with a single handpiece.
To support high-power, high-frequency treatments (up to 20Hz), laser handles utilize a combination of Peltier cooling, microchannel liquid flow, and sapphire tips. This ensures skin temperatures remain comfortable while delivering therapeutic doses to target structures.
Integrating Fast Axis Collimation (FAC) lenses directly onto laser bars reduces divergence angles significantly. This concentrates energy output, resulting in higher spot homogeneity and better skin penetration depth without heat dispersion.

A high-quality diode laser stack using gold tin (AuSn) bonding technology typically lasts between 20 million to 50 million shots, depending on operating conditions, water quality, and cooling efficiency. Utilizing macro-channel or micro-channel coolers with deionized water filtration significantly extends diode stack longevity.

Microchannel coolers utilize narrow micro-channels directly underneath the laser bars to maximize heat dissipation, allowing for higher power densities and longer continuous runs. Macrochannel coolers feature larger water channels, which are less sensitive to water quality but offer slightly lower heat transfer efficiency compared to MCC designs.
A FAC lens is a micro-cylindrical optical element that collimates the highly divergent light emitting from the fast axis of a diode laser bar. By collimating the beam, the energy remains concentrated over longer distances, improving energy density and depth penetration while minimizing thermal loss.
